Transaction 8fcac7c285eab23fa824e9ef0edf0268705bb01b61749d14fd20bd8e28fd011a

1 Input
2 Outputs
  • 8fcac7c285eab23fa824e9ef0edf0268705bb01b61749d14fd20bd8e28fd011a:0
  • value  253905
    address  mz95gqDmCYU5tFdumUPQdHz7XJrAtiwwwo
  • 8fcac7c285eab23fa824e9ef0edf0268705bb01b61749d14fd20bd8e28fd011a:1
  • value  9646094
    address  2NDyGsQC2CWLqxNTfk9xyVBYdGyTuKSTZD9